Fractions of Forever
If I leave you for a year, I'll be content to know, Within another hemisphere You set the night aglow And when I'd close my eyes to sleep, To God I make my plea, In dreams allow my heart to leap The distance 'cross the sea A year is, sadly, more than never, But little in degree, What is a fraction of forever? We have eternity Whatever we may think or say, Whatever we may do, Wherever on this Earth I stray, I will return to you
